Step-by-step instructions and coordinating photography to paint four … WebI mix varnish (polyurethane) with paint thinner 3:2. ( 60% of varnish and 40% of paint thinner) 2. I apply mixture on the carving – as much as the wood absorbs (a lot! – the more the better) 3. I let it dry about 24 hours or until dry 4. I use steel wool to clean all the little fuzzy stuff on my carving 5.

WebMake a heavily diluted wash with 1 drop of Americana burnt umber and water. Use the wash to highlight the crevices where the fortune cookie is split and under the ragged edge all around. Mix an acrylic paint wash with 3 drops of FolkArt yellow ochre, 2 drops Ceramcoat yellow, and 2 drops of Ceramcoat pumpkin. WebOne of the most popular ways many wood carvers protect their carvings is by using acrylic paints to add some extra life and color to their works of art. This can really make your wood carvings stand out and be a great addition to any shelf for decoration. Acrylic paints are easy to apply and are quite versatile.
